Elk River Public Library Board Page 5 <br />January 28, 2020 <br />Mrs. Schake presented her report. Ms. Schake received two <br />estimates from a local upholstery company, one to re -upholster <br />entire chairs for $1750 and one to re -upholster just the seats of <br />the chairs for $670. She is open to the boards input. <br />Commissioner Eberley and Chair Keifenheim said they think <br />that they should cover the whole chair. Ms. Shake will ask for a <br />board member to go with to choose the fabric. <br />Moved by Commissioner Eberley and seconded by Commissioner <br />Hegarty to approve Ms. Schake to choose fabric and spend the $1750. <br />5.6 GRRL Trustee Report <br />• GRRL trustee report: march campaign coming up- money will stay local to Elk <br />River. Commissioner Hagerty has a lot of books to give away due to her job as a <br />book editor. She explained that the Friends of the Library should be receiving <br />books from her suppliers. Commissioner Eberley talked about how nice it <br />would be to give a book to everyone that signed up for the summer reading <br />program. <br />6. Announcements <br />7. Adjournment <br />Moved by Commissioner Eberley and seconded by Commissioner Boelter to <br />adjourn the meeting. Motion carried 5-0.
